2. Building Scalable and Efficient Data Models
One of the core functions of a Power BI consultant is optimizing data models for efficiency. Poorly structured data models can lead to slow report performance and incorrect analytics.
Key Contributions:
- Develops data models that support high-performance reporting.
- Optimizes relationships between tables to reduce redundancy.
- Implements best practices for DAX (Data Analysis Expressions) formulas.
How This Helps:
- Improves report processing speed.
- Reduces unnecessary data load and enhances scalability.
- Enables smooth and efficient querying of data.
3. Seamless Data Integration from Multiple Sources
Businesses often store data in different systems, such as CRM platforms, databases, and cloud storage solutions. Power BI consultants specialize in integrating these diverse data sources into a unified reporting structure.
Key Contributions:
- Connects Power BI to on-premise and cloud-based data sources.
- Ensures secure data integration while maintaining compliance.
- Sets up automated data refresh schedules for real-time reporting.
How This Helps:
- Creates a single source of truth for business data.
- Eliminates manual data consolidation efforts.
- Provides up-to-date insights for decision-makers.
